I remember reading a very interesting explanation to this fascinating portion of the Bible. Apparently, it was claimed the writing on the wall consisted of the following consonant letters in the Hebrew language; Mn Mn Tkl Uphrsn
The Babylonian “wise men” did not know what the letters signified so they had to send for Daniel. As Daniel was a Hebrew and knew the Hebrew language, he knew right away where to place the vowels between the consonant letters. Thus Daniel was able to deliver the message precisely.
Dan 5:25 And this is the writing that was written, Mene, Mene, Tekel, Upharsin.
